I was wondeing if anyone could help me.........

my ****y netgear router has died (more specificly, the modem in it has died) leaving me with only one pc in the house with boradband.... the router still works as a network router, it just can't/won't dial up (yes I have checked all the settings, the internet light doesn't even work on the initial turn on test).

Now I can dial up on my desktop, turn on connection sharing and the laptop will hapilly share the internet connection fora few minutes, then it all locks up... I have even tried turning off firewalls!!!! is there a specific way of doing it so that it works reliably?? (other then buy a new router)

Are you using the router as a switch to connect the laptop and the computer?

If yes make sure DHCP is disabled on the router as once you enable ICS the pc becomes a DHCP server -having 2 is just going to cause problems!
